What is the base for the expression -6 to the power of 4

Respuesta :

carlosego
carlosego carlosego
  • 25-03-2020

For this case we have that by definition it is fulfilled:

[tex]a ^ b[/tex]

Where:

a: It is the base

b: It is the exponent

So, if we have the following expression:

-6 to the power of 4, is equivalent to: [tex](-6) ^ 4[/tex]

So we have to:

-6: It is the base

4: It is the exponent

Answer:

-6: It is the base

4: It is the exponent
